Output 62f6faa3c17a589726038815b2f7cf20f02f2e5d9d7eec9b5f6cef00a52aa43a:0

value
30730185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cd5ff4969166c93378bb3e8f8ed5999810828ec OP_EQUAL
address
32rtPdf2A54Pgbe9pbuxcsemXPc2Zq8ezd
transaction
62f6faa3c17a589726038815b2f7cf20f02f2e5d9d7eec9b5f6cef00a52aa43a
spent
true